A is shaped like a rectangle whose perimeter is 378ft . The length is 8 times as long as the width. Find the length and the width.
The length and width of the rectangle with a perimeter of 378ft are 168ft and 21ft respectively.
What is the length and the width of the rectangle?The formula used in calculating the perimeter of a rectangle is expressed as;
P = 2( l + w )
Where l is length and w is width.
Given the data in the question;
Let 'x' represent the width of the rectangle.
Width of the rectangle w = xLength of the rectangle l = 8xPerimeter P = 378ftPlug the given values into perimeter formula and solve for x .
P = 2( l + w )
378 = 2( 8x + x )
378 = 2( 9x )
378 = 18x
18x = 378
x = 378/18
x = 21
Now, we find the length and width of the rectangle.
Width of the rectangle w = x = 21ft
Length of the rectangle l = 8x = 8( 21 ) = 168ft
Therefore, the width of the rectangle is 21ft while its length is 168ft.

In a direct variation, y=9 when x=3. Write a direct variation equation that shows the relationship between x and y.
In a direct variation, y=9 when x=3. A direct variation equation that shows the relationship between x and y is y=3x
What do you mean by direct variation?
Direct variation is a type of proportionality when one quantity changes right away in reaction to a change in another variable. This implies that if one number rises, the other will follow suit in a comparable manner. Similar to the last illustration, if one quantity decreases, the other quantity also decreases. Direct variation will have a linear relationship with the graph, resulting in a straight line.
Given,
In a direct variation, y=9 when x=3.
Formulate an equation based on the conditions stated: y=kx
We put the value of the y and x in this equation
9=k*3
Subtract the coefficient of the variable from both sides of the equation
k= 3
We can write the equation of the function by putting the value of k: y=3x
Hence the correct answer is y=3x

if a ferry boat covers 28 miles in 4 hours how much distance will it cover in 12 hours?
Answer:
84 miles in 12 hour
Step-by-step explanation:
12/4 = 3
3*28=84
Answer:
84 miles.
Step-by-step explanation:
First, find the rate of miles travel per hour. It is given that the boat covers 28 miles in 4 hours. Simply divide 28 with 4:
28/4 = 7
The boat covers 7 miles per hour.
Now, multiply 12 hours with 7:
12 hours x 7 miles per hour = 84 miles per 12 hours.
84 miles is your answer.
